欢聚时代 Java开发工程师
这几天在牛客网看了许多有关Java的面试问题,对自己在欢聚时代的面试还是有帮助的,至少让自己的自信提高了不少(如果面试官问道我这样的问题,那我就能答了(阿Q精神哈))。好了,言归正传哈!
我是10号在YY第一面,问的问题是关于spring的,比如,如果使用spring
mvc,那post请求跟put请求有什么区别啊;spring aop底层实现是使用什么机制啊,这个时候你说动态***,那spring
aop用到了那些动态***实现,有什么区别啊;Java SE基础有问对多线程的理解。还有些什么不太记得了。
第一面面完之后感觉还不错,虽然那天我自己感觉面试官好像不太喜欢问问题,最后,我就自己去问他,把自己擅长的一部分说出来,结合欢聚时代公司的产品可能注重的技术。
12号也就是今天在YY第二面,说实话,今天的面试感觉不太好,面试官直接问我简历中的项目开问,比如,你这项目中你觉得哪一方面你觉得比较好,然后好在哪里,它有什么缺点。如果有多种实现方案,那么你为何不使用那种技术,而使用这个。还有问你对项目中在方案实现方面的选择,你考虑了什么,为啥你选择它。比如本人就说了缓存技术,我使用了redis,没有使用mem***d,我当时考虑的点,然后面试官就猛抓你为啥选择redis,不选这mem***d,然后说了考虑的点,面试官就问这个怎么在mem***d就不好呢?等等。最后,我想把面试官移到我比较懂的地方去,本人就说有看过Java
SE的一些主要框架源码,我说Collection框架,然后面试官就问我你是仔细认真看懂了它的源代码还是只是稍微了解。还有问了对ConcurrentHashMap的底层实现。主要就是这些
非常感谢牛客网提供的这个平台,让我们可以增加一些面试经验。
#Java工程师#